“Hoarder of a Different Order”
(Lyrics By Chuck Webster – Music M. Novak)
He was a hoarder of a different order
Asking questions and collecting people's thoughts
Never thinking it odd to ask beyond their borders
Finding most talked about kids, dogs and what they bought
A hoarder of a different order
Standing on a soap box gathering a crowd
Waiting until they would erupt with no concession
Folks would shout and yell their thoughts aloud
And tell him their life stories without any suggestion
A hoarder of a different order
CHORUS:
Collector of thoughts – Finding life's meaning
Collector of thought – His ideas were teeming
Collector of thoughts – He had much to unmask
Collector of thoughts – He was just never asked
What he heard was simple, all talk about another
How long people could talk without taking a breath
All at once speaking not thinking of any others
He wondered if these folks could talk until death
A hoarder of a different order
He never looked away from their eyes while listening
Gave the impression they were someone special
He would listen intently to quench his needing
Hoarding was his way of filling this vessel
A hoarder of a different order
CHORUS:
Years of collecting all the ideas that they spewed
Left him with wisdom and insights galore
He would lay back and ponder what he knew
Knowing was his passion and all that he looked for
As he thought about life and found listening his task
One thing stood out, not a question he was asked
